I was having this same problem with snv_134. I executed all the same commands as you did. The cloned disk booted up to the "Hostname:" line and then died. Booting with the "-kv" kernel option in GRUB, it died at a different point each time, most commonly after:
"srn0 is /pseudo/s...@0" What's worse, my primary disk wouldn't boot either! I tried all manner of swapping disks in and out, unplugging & plugging certain disks, changing boot order in BIOS, etc. These are PATA disks and I tried changing master to slave, slave to master, booting with one drive but not the other, enabling/disabling DMA on the drives, etc. But anyway, after my customary 8 hours of Googling, I found the fix: http://bugs.opensolaris.org/bugdatabase/view_bug.do?bug_id=6923585 Looks like I neglected to detach the mirror before removing it... -- This message posted from opensolaris.org _______________________________________________ zfs-discuss mailing list zfs-discuss@opensolaris.org http://mail.opensolaris.org/mailman/listinfo/zfs-discuss
